Primary diagnostics and checking the integrity of the lamp

The most obvious and most common reason for the lack of light is the failure of the light bulb itself. Despite the fact that modern LED elements last for years, older models still use classic incandescent lamps, which tend to burn out. Compressor vibration and voltage drops in the network often become factors that shorten the service life of the lighting device.

To verify the malfunction, it is necessary to remove the lamp from the base. Visual inspection of the filament in incandescent lamps will often reveal a break immediately. If the thread is intact and the light still does not light, the problem may lie in the socket or contacts. In some cases, oxidation of the contacts leads to a lack of connection even with a serviceable element.

⚠️ Attention: Before starting any work to remove the lamp, be sure to disconnect the refrigerator from the power supply. Unplug the plug from the socket to eliminate the risk of electric shock if you accidentally touch live parts.

If you have a multimeter, you can “ring” the light bulb in resistance testing mode. The absence of a response from the device will confirm that the element is faulty and requires replacement. For refrigerators Indesit E14 standard lamps with a power of no more than 15 W are usually used. Exceeding this parameter can lead to melting of the lampshade or socket.

Failure of the limit switch (light switch button)

The second most common culprit of darkness in the chamber is the limit switch, or, as it is often called, the limit switch. This is a mechanical device that opens or closes an electrical circuit depending on the position of the refrigerator door. When you open the door, the spring pushes the button and the light comes on.

Over time, the limit switch mechanism can “stick” or oxidize. The internal contacts stop closing even when pressed, and no current flows to the lamp. In refrigerators Indesit this element is often located in the upper part of the chamber, next to the lampshade, but in some models it may be shifted to the side. You can check its operation by pressing the button with your finger when the door is open.

  • 🔌 Mechanical jamming: the button does not physically return to its original position or moves too tightly, the mechanism requires lubrication or replacement.
  • Oxidation of contacts: a deposit has formed inside the switch, preventing passage current, cleaning or installing a new element is necessary.
  • ❄️ Icing: in old refrigerators with manual defrosting, condensation can freeze around the button, blocking its movement.

Replacing the limit switch does not always require complete disassembly of the unit. Often it is enough to carefully pry up the plastic cover and remove the faulty part. However, it is worth considering that new models may have electronic sensors instead of mechanical buttons, the diagnosis of which requires more in-depth knowledge.

Problems with wiring and cartridges

If the lamp is working and the limit switch is working, you should pay attention to the condition of the wiring. The vibration created by a running refrigerator compressor Indesitcan weaken the contacts at the joints over time. The wires may rub against the metal edges of the housing or melt during a short circuit.

Particular attention should be paid to the cartridge. In models with incandescent lamps, the plastic around the base often becomes deformed due to heat. This leads to the fact that the socket contacts move away from the lamp base, and the electrical circuit does not close. Visually, this may look like blackened or melted plastic around the light bulb hole.

Wiring repairs require care. It is necessary to ring each section of the circuit from the plug to the lamp. If a break is detected, the wire should be replaced or the connection restored by soldering, carefully insulating the contact point. The use of low-quality electrical tape in conditions of low temperature and humidity of the refrigeration chamber is unacceptable.

How to check the integrity of the wire with a multimeter?

Turn the multimeter into the continuity mode. Press one probe to the beginning of the wire, the other to the end. If a beep sounds, the wire is intact. If there is silence, look for a break or change the wire completely.

Ordinary wires at low temperatures become brittle and can crack, which will lead to a short circuit. When replacing, use only specialized materials.

Specifics of LED lighting in new models

In modern refrigerators Indesit LED lighting systems are increasingly used. They are more economical and more durable, but their repair has its own characteristics. If the LED strip or light in your unit does not light up, simply replacing the element may not help, since the problem often lies in the driver (power supply).

LEDs are sensitive to voltage changes. A surge in the network could damage not the lamp itself, but the control board. Unlike incandescent lamps, you cannot simply “unscrew and screw in” a new part. Often it is necessary to replace the entire backlight module or repair the electronic control board.

Type of malfunction Symptoms Difficulty of repair
LED crystal burnout Lamp does not light, visible damage no High (needs soldering)
Driver malfunction Flickering or complete absence of light Medium (replacement unit)
Cable break The light disappears when the door is opened Low (contact restoration)

Diagnostics of LED systems requires a circuit diagram for a specific refrigerator. Without understanding exactly how the diodes in your model are powered Indesit, it is dangerous to climb inside the control unit. An error can lead to failure of the main refrigerator controller.

Instructions for replacing a light bulb in an Indesit refrigerator

Replacing a light bulb is a procedure available to any user and does not require special skills. The main thing is to follow the sequence of actions and safety precautions. The process takes no more than 10-15 minutes and allows you to save on calling a technician.

First you need to find the lampshade. In most models Indesit it is located in the upper part of the refrigerator compartment, sometimes covered with a plastic lid. Fastening can be done with latches or screws. You must act carefully so as not to damage the fragile plastic, which becomes especially brittle in the cold.

After dismantling the lampshade, you will see the lamp base. Unscrew it carefully. If the lamp is “stuck” due to oxidation, you can try to shake it slightly, but without excessive force, so as not to break the glass in your hand. Screw in the new lamp as far as it will go, but without fanaticism, so as not to damage the thread of the socket.

⚠️ Attention: Never use lamps with a power higher than that specified in the instructions (usually 15 W). Excessive heat can melt the plastic lampshade or deform the internal lining of the chamber.

Common mistakes during self-repair

Trying to save on repairs, refrigerator owners Indesit often make typical mistakes that may lead to more serious damage. One of the most common is ignoring the disconnection of the device from the network. Even if you are only changing the lamp, the risk of touching live parts or dropping a metal object on the contacts remains high.

Another mistake is using the wrong tools. An attempt to pry off a plastic lampshade with a knife or screwdriver often ends in scratches on the body or chips of the plastic. It is better to use special plastic spatulas or at least a flat object with a wide blunt edge, wrapped in a soft cloth.

Also, users often forget to check the voltage in the network. If there is a voltage surge in the house, the new lamp may burn out almost immediately after installation. In such cases, it is recommended to use stabilizers or at least make sure that the problem is not in the general electrical network of the apartment.

When you need to contact a specialist

Despite the simplicity of the design of the lighting system, there are times when independent repair is impossible or dangerous. If, after replacing the lamp and limit switch, the light does not appear, the problem may lie deeper - in the control module or hidden wiring, which cannot be reached without disassembling the housing.

You also need the help of a technician if you notice traces of burning, melted wiring, or smell the smell of burnt plastic. These are signs of a serious short circuit that may cause a fire. In such cases, operation of the refrigerator Indesit must be stopped immediately.

If you have a model with a system No Frost and complex electronics, any intervention in the electrical part without appropriate qualifications can disrupt the settings or damage the sensors. It is better to entrust the diagnostics to professionals who have access to original spare parts and circuits.

Is it possible to use an LED lamp instead of a regular one?

Yes, you can if the base matches (usually E14). However, make sure that the LED lamp is designed to work in refrigerators (has the appropriate temperature range) and does not interfere with electronics.

Why does the light blink when the door is opened?

Blinking usually indicates poor contact in the socket, oxidation of the limit switch contacts, or unstable voltage in the network. This may also be a sign of imminent failure of the lamp itself.

Where can I find the part number to replace the lampshade?

The part number (part number) is usually indicated on the inside of the lampshade itself or in the technical documentation of the refrigerator Indesit. It can also be found by refrigerator model in spare parts catalogues.
